    Trillogy - I Wanna Rock (Mixtape) - Download Now

    Trillogy, one of Hip-Hop's most promising groups, is realeasing new bangers from their anticipated debut mixtape "Love, Life, Loyalty Vol. 1" via Starr Media Group.

    "Love, Life, Loyalty Vol. 1", hosted by DJ Radio from Street Sweeper Radio and presented and mixed by IDJ, is available for download now! The mixtape features an incredible array of Trillogy's famous "Trillmixes" as well as brand new tracks from the Hip-Hop trio that won "Most Promising Hip-Hop Group" (2008) and "Song Of The Year" (2009) at the popular Underground Music Awards (UMAs) in New York City.

    The legendary MC and founder of the world famous Hip-Hop group GangStarr, Guru aka Mr. GangStarr, offers his fans and urban music enthusiastics his chart-topping first Hip-Hop solo album "Version 7.0: The Street Scriptures" (2005) for free download [limited time]. "The 'Street Scriptures' is one of my best albums too date! It is right up there with my GangStarr records, and a classic. The album was our first release on 7 Grand Records. The sound and scope of the 'Street Scriptures' is very futuristic, and innovative. I also am very proud of the single ' Hood Dreamin' and the music video. This is a great album and any real Hip-Hop head will find something on this album that they will enjoy if not the whole album. The features are outstanding. So here it is for you and yours 'Version 7.0: The Street Scriptures'. " says Guru

    Eternia - Get Caught Up Mixtape

    In a industry starved for more legitimate female emcees (Jean, where you at?), Eternia is a breath of fresh air. She's on a long list of talented female emcees who haven't received the recognition they deserve. If you're not familiar with Eternia, Get Caught Up, with this mixtape presented by 2dopeboyz and Kevin Nottingham. Here's a message from Eternia: "These are not ‘pop’ songs. These are not video singles. These are not Top 10 hits. This is the heart and soul of why I do what I do when I do it. This is a personal offering. It’s my huge THANK YOU to all of the people who have supported the Eternia & MoSS: 'ROAD TO RELEASE' video episodes online over the last 6 months. I hand-picked these songs from the past decade, b/c I felt they are overlooked, they are the most personal to my life, and they reveal my growth as an artist."     Message From Eternia:

    I get a lot of questions from my family, friends and fans about the “411: Because I am A Girl” school tour. I figured instead of trying to explain what I do, as a Hip Hop artist, at these schools. I would show you.

    I am blessed to tour with a wonderful family of inspiring ladies: Nana (who is shown hyping me up in these clips, but she hosts the entire show!), Hip Hop artist Masia One,and the founder of The 411 Initiative for Change & these school tour programs, Tamara Dawit. We even have our very own DJ – Kyle – who, besides tour managing, driving, doing our sound, and generally doing everything else, also reps “Because I Am A Girl” proudly. :-D

    A special shout out goes to the students of all the Ontario schools featured in this video: Marymount Academy in Sudbury, Brechin P.S. in Brechin, Cathy Wever in Hamilton, Assumption in St. Thomas, and Sioux Mountain in Sioux Lookout.
